The Sauti Project is a USAID-funded active to improve the health of all Tanzanians through a sustained reduction in new HIV infections in support of the Government of the United Republic of Tanzania. Sauti uses vulnerability-tailored, evidence-based interventions to bring high-quality HIV prevention, HIV adherence support, and family planning promotion and service delivery to key and vulnerable populations (KVPs) in selected regions of mainland Tanzania .The following vacant posts are available for immediate, filling with the Sauti project.
